Rocket League Season 7 Is Really A “Shiny” New Update
There’s a lot of guilding going on.
Today, Psyonix kicked off the seventh competitive season (since F2P launch) for its soccer car game, Rocket League. The new season is super-shiny, featuring the new car ‘Maestro’, a new arena, and all kinds of shiny rewards. The Maestro, like several things in this update, has a guilded look with gold grills and other accents. More important to gameplay is the fact that it uses the Dominus hitbox.
In keeping with the shiny theme, the new arena, the ‘Utopia Coliseum (Guilded)', is now available in online playlists, private matches, and free play. There are even some shiny new items for Pride month, including a sequin paint finish and a Tiara: Multichrome topper. These are part of the ‘Shine Through’ bundle which also contains new anthems from queer artists like Trixie Mattel, Todrick Hall, Adore Delano, and Conchita Wurst.
